如何充分利用区块链技术
2026-03-05
在当今数字经济迅速发展的时代,区块链技术与开源平台的结合,为各行各业带来了前所未有的机遇。这两者不仅能够推动技术的创新与进步,还能够实现资源的配置,促进社会各领域的发展。通过对区块链技术的深入了解,以及开源平台的灵活应用,企业与开发者都能够在这个充满挑战和机遇的市场中立于不败之地。
本文将围绕“如何充分利用区块链技术与开源平台推动创新与发展”这一主题展开详细讨论,首先介绍区块链技术的基本概念与特点,接着分析开源平台的优势,以及两者结合的潜在价值。随后,我们将讨论在实际应用过程中可能遇到的问题,并给出相应的解决方案。同时,我们也会解答一些与区块链和开源平台相关的问题,帮助读者更好地理解这一领域的最新动态和发展趋势。
区块链作为一种新兴的分布式账本技术,最初因比特币而为人所知。它通过去中心化的方式,记录和管理交易信息。区块链的核心特点主要包括去中心化、不可篡改和透明性。
首先,去中心化是区块链技术的最大特点之一。在传统的中心化系统中,所有的数据都由一个中心节点管理,这容易导致单点故障和数据泄露。而区块链技术则通过多个节点共同维护数据,避免了中心化管理带来的各种风险。
其次,区块链的不可篡改性意味着一旦数据记录在区块链上,就不可能被修改或删除。这一特点确保了数据的真实性与可信度,消除了信息不对称的问题,为各方参与者提供了信任基础。
最后,区块链的透明性使得交易记录对所有参与者开放,任何人都可以查看。这种开放性有助于提高系统的信用度,并预防欺诈行为的发生。
开源平台是指可以自由使用、修改和分发的软件系统,其最大优势在于社区的协作与创新。开源软件通过集结来自世界各地的开发者资源,快速实现了技术的迭代和改进。
首先,开源平台通常具有较低的使用成本。因为开源软件是免费的,企业能够有效减少软件采购成本,从而把更多资源投入到业务发展中。
其次,开源平台的灵活性允许用户根据自身需求进行定制和扩展。开发者可以对开源代码进行修改,以适应特定的业务需求,进而提升软件的适用性与效率。
再者,开源软件拥有广泛的社区支持。开发者可以通过社区获取技术支持、分享经验与解决方案。这种开放的合作环境,有助于加速技术的创新和产品的升级。
将区块链技术与开源平台结合,能够创造出更高效、更安全的解决方案。一方面,区块链的去中心化特性可以增强开源平台的安全性,减少单点故障的风险。另一方面,开源平台的灵活性与创新性能够有效推动区块链技术的发展,使其应用更为广泛。
首先,通过开源的方式,实现区块链项目的透明化和可审计性,是推动企业和个人参与的关键。用户能够对区块链应用的底层代码进行审查,了解其运作逻辑,从而增强对项目的信任度。
其次,开源区块链项目有助于形成开放社区,吸引更多开发者参与。随着区块链技术的不断演进,开源社区的力量能够有效促成技术的快速迭代与创新,推动整个行业的发展。
最后,结合区块链技术的自动化合约功能,可以帮助开源平台实现更加智能化的操作。比如,在某些协议达成后,区块链可以自动执行合约,减少了人工干预的需求,提高了效率。
区块链技术的安全性主要依赖于其结构和共识机制。由于区块链是由多个节点共同维护的分布式网络,任何一方都无法单独控制整个网络,因此,数据篡改的难度极大。同时,区块链使用加密算法来确保数据的安全性和传输过程的隐私性,确保交易各方的信息在网络中是不可见的。
另一个保障区块链安全性的重要机制是共识机制。不同类型的区块链采用不同的共识机制,如工作量证明(PoW)、权利证明(PoS)等。这些机制不仅能防止恶意攻击,还能保障网络的正常运行,确保数据一致性。
然而,尽管区块链技术本身具备较高的安全性,实际应用中仍可能面临一些安全风险,如智能合约漏洞、私钥管理失误等。因此,用户和开发者需对区块链技术深入了解,采取适当措施确保安全。
开源平台的版权和知识产权主要通过开源协议进行规定。这些协议定义了软件的使用、修改和分发条件,明确了开发者的权利与义务。常见的开源协议包括GNU通用公共许可证(GPL)、Apache许可证等,每种协议在版权保护上有所不同。
开源协议能够保护原作者的权益,同时允许其他开发者对其进行修改和二次开发。这种机制虽然鼓励了技术的传播与合作,但也需要用户在使用开源软件时了解相应的许可证,遵循规定,以避免侵犯他人的知识产权。
此外,为了进一步保护开源项目,社区也在不断探索新的方式,比如通过建立基金会、实施双许可证等,以确保项目的持续发展与维护。
区块链技术在企业数字化转型中起到了重要作用。首先,区块链能够提高数据的透明性与安全性,减少跨部门、跨公司之间信息沟通的障碍。企业可以通过区块链实现数据共享,各部门之间能够实现更高效的协作与决策。
其次,通过智能合约,企业能够实现自动化的业务流程。智能合约可以根据预设条件自动执行,减少人工干预,提高效率。此外,这种机制还可以降低合同执行的成本,减少纠纷。
另外,区块链的去中心化特性可以帮助企业重构传统的商业模式。在某些行业,传统中央机构存在效率低下、成本高、透明度不足的问题,通过区块链,企业能够与消费者直接连接,实现资源的最优配置与价值的最大化。
综上所述,区块链技术为企业数字化转型提供了重要工具,能够有效提升运营效率、降低成本、创造新价值。
随着区块链技术的逐步成熟,其与开源的结合也将在未来发展中展现出更多可能性。首先,随着区块链技术应用的普及,越来越多的开源项目将围绕区块链展开,形成新的开发生态系统。
其次,区块链和开源的结合将促进合作文化的形成。越来越多的企业意识到,开放合作是推动技术创新的重要策略,借助开源社区的力量能够更快推动产品迭代与成熟。
此外,随着区块链和开源技术的深入发展,法律法规的建设也将越来越完善。各国政府和行业组织将加强对区块链与开源的监管,以保障用户权益,推动健康可持续的发展。
在发展趋势的引导下,企业与开发者应更加重视对区块链技术与开源平台的学习与应用,把握机会,提升自身竞争力。
综合上述内容,区块链技术与开源平台的结合为各行业带来了广阔的前景。在不断变化的市场环境中,只有持续创新与开放合作,才能够在未来的科技浪潮中立于不败之地。